5-Fluoro-1-pentanol is a colorless liquid, identified by its CAS number 592-80-3. Its molecular formula is C5H11FO, with a molecular weight of approximately 106.14 g/mol. Key physical properties reported include a boiling point of around 129.8°C and a flash point of 61.6°C, classifying it as a combustible liquid. Its density is approximately 0.93 g/cm³. Understanding these parameters is crucial for safe storage, transportation, and application. When you purchase this chemical, reviewing its Safety Data Sheet (SDS) is a mandatory first step.

Regarding safety and handling, 5-Fluoro-1-pentanol requires diligent attention. As a combustible liquid, it should be kept away from heat, sparks, and open flames. It may cause skin and eye irritation, and inhalation of vapors should be avoided. Proper personal protective equipment (PPE), including gloves, safety glasses, and lab coats, should always be worn when handling this compound. Working in a well-ventilated area, preferably a fume hood, is recommended. Responsible storage in a cool, dry place, away from incompatible materials such as strong oxidizers and acids, is essential for maintaining product integrity and safety.

For procurement managers and laboratory personnel, familiarizing themselves with the GHS hazard statements, such as H227 (Combustible liquid), H315 (Causes skin irritation), H319 (Causes serious eye irritation), and H335 (May cause respiratory irritation), is vital. These indications help in implementing appropriate safety protocols. We recommend always consulting the most current SDS provided by the supplier before use.
